Overview

Streamlined visa for delegates, speakers, moderators, and media practitioners attending meetings, conferences, incentives, and exhibitions in Namibia.

The MICE (Meetings, Incentives, Conferences, and Exhibitions) Visa is a streamlined, specialized entry category recently introduced by the Namibian Ministry of Home Affairs, Immigration, Safety and Security. It was developed to position Namibia as a premier destination for international business events, filling the gap where standard tourist visas were insufficient for professional delegates and short-term work permits were overly burdensome for event participants. It simplifies the administrative process for large-scale corporate and professional gatherings.

This visa is specifically for delegates, speakers, moderators, sponsors, and media practitioners attending registered MICE events in Namibia. It is distinct because it requires the event convener to register the event with the Namibia Convention Bureau to obtain a unique event code, which delegates then use to apply. This process is faster than traditional work permits and is tailored for professionals who need to conduct business-related activities, such as presenting or facilitating, without the complexities of a long-term employment visa.

Requirements

ELIGIBILITY REQUIREMENTS

Valid passport with at least 6 months validity

Official event invitation letter

Unique MICE Event Visa code (provided by event organizers)

Proof of registration for the specific conference, meeting, or event

Proof of accommodation and travel itinerary

Payment of the visa fee (NAD 1600)

Accreditation from the Ministry of Information and Communication Technology (for media representatives)

Advantages & Considerations

Key Benefits

  • Streamlined process specifically for professional delegates, speakers, and moderators
  • Replaces the need for a short-term work permit for most professional event-related activities
  • Fast application process (often under 15 minutes)
  • Digital visa and QR code format

Worth Knowing

  • Requires a specific event number to proceed with the application
  • Strictly limited to the purpose of the event (meetings, incentives, conferences, exhibitions)
  • Not for general employment or business activities outside the event scope
  • Must be applied for in advance of travel

Application Process

1

Register for the specific MICE event to receive an invitation letter and event code

2

Wait for the required processing period (usually 3 days after registration confirmation)

3

Apply online via the MHAISS e-Services portal using the event code

4

Upload necessary documents including the invitation letter

5

Pay the visa fee (NAD 1600) online upon approval

6

Receive the digital visa and QR code

7

Present the digital visa/QR code at the port of entry
